*/\r
public void actionPerformed(ActionEvent arg0) {\r
\r
- docConsole.setSaved(false);\r
if (arg0.getSource() == jButtonOk) {\r
this.save();\r
this.dispose();\r
JOptionPane.showMessageDialog(this, "Msa File is NOT PathAndFilename type.");\r
return;\r
}\r
+ \r
+ String dirPrefix = Tools.dirForNewSpd.substring(0, Tools.dirForNewSpd.lastIndexOf(File.separator));\r
+ if (!new File(dirPrefix + File.separator + jTextField.getText()).exists()) {\r
+ JOptionPane.showMessageDialog(this, "File NOT Exists in Current Package.");\r
+ return;\r
+ }\r
model.addRow(row);\r
jTable.changeSelection(model.getRowCount()-1, 0, false, false);\r
sfc.genSpdMsaFiles(row[0], null, null, null);\r
+ docConsole.setSaved(false);\r
}\r
//\r
// remove selected line\r
if (rowSelected >= 0) {\r
model.removeRow(rowSelected);\r
sfc.removeSpdMsaFile(rowSelected);\r
+ docConsole.setSaved(false);\r
}\r
}\r
\r
}\r
model.setRowCount(0);\r
sfc.removeSpdMsaFile();\r
+ docConsole.setSaved(false);\r
}\r
\r
}\r